
Georgian Harcho Soup
Description
Perfect for lunch. Here is a simple recipe for Georgian harcho soup. I think it will appeal to everyone who is tired of the usual soups and wants to try something new. This soup turns out slightly tangy thanks to the tomatoes, and thanks to the abundance of spicy spices, it's piquant and very aromatic! Instructions
- 1
Step 1

1. Place the beef in water, wait for the water to boil and skim off all the foam. Then add the washed vegetables whole into the broth and simmer for one and a half hours over low heat, covered. When the meat becomes tender, remove it and cut into pieces. Then return it to the broth and remove the vegetables.
- 2
Step 2

2. Finely chop the onion and garlic and sauté in vegetable oil. Then add the well-rinsed rice and fry until the rice turns slightly golden. Transfer everything to the broth. Add the tomatoes, rubbed into a puree. Bring to a boil.
- 3
Step 3

3. Separately grind the salt, cumin, saffron, and pepper, then add the cilantro, crush in a mortar, and add the mixture to the soup as a seasoning. Cook until the rice is done.
- 4
Step 4

4. Simmer the soup over low heat for about an hour. And here's the beauty you get!
